Medical Staff Services Management Overview:
The Medical Staff Services Management (MSSM) degree is designed to prepare graduates to work in a hospital or health care facility as a credentialing expert.
A certified MSSM is qualified to become an integral part of health care administration that would be responsible for: managing compliance, adherence to governing bylaws, credentialing of staff, operations management (staffing, budgets, database administration, etc.), continuing education, and upholding organizational policies, procedures and regulations.

Certification:
The coursework for the MSSM program may help prepare you for the Certified Professional in Medical Services Management (CPMSM) or the Certified Professional Credentialing Specialist (CPCS) examinations which are recognized as the standard in the medical services profession and are a symbol of excellence within the industry.
Earning these credentials signifies that an individual has demonstrated the knowledge and skills required to perform competently in today's complex medical credentialing environment. |
